Subject: Canteen access during your visit

Dear contractors,

From this week, the ground-floor canteen at Merrow Point is shared with our neighbours at Dunhaven Analytics, so expect it to be busier between 12:00 and 13:30. Visiting contractors are welcome to use it, but please keep your visitor lanyard visible and return trays to the racks by the east wall. The canteen's side entrance from the courtyard is kept locked; you can enter with the code below.

badge for fafop-fajof: bdg-Z-47

Capacity note: Slatemap tile cache

The render cache on the Korvane cluster is sized for last quarter's traffic. With the new vector basemap launch, hot-tile churn doubled and eviction rates spiked. If hit ratio drops below 0.85 overnight, do not restart the cache nodes — that flushes warm entries and makes things worse. Instead, bump shard memory and widen the TTL per the runbook. Headroom math assumes 1.4x weekend peak. The constants the cache layer currently runs with are listed below.

constants for bagag-fawip:
BUDGETS = {
    "wenius": 400,
    "brieth": 224,
    "rusath": 783,
    "eliys": 187,
    "aldax": 737,
    "ralion": 818,
    "istius": 153,
}

The Waveform Preview service renders audio previews for the Soundloft editor. As a contractor, you will use the shared service account rather than personal credentials; it has read-only access to the transcode queue. Rotate nothing without approval from the media platform lead. For local testing, authenticate using the service account key below.

app token of yajeg-kawef = kto11_7En3XSX8xQw

# Break-Glass Access: Snaplark UI Snapshot Store

Snapshot baselines for Veltro UI components live in the Snaplark store; CI compares against them on every merge. If the store is unreachable and a release is blocked, break-glass access lets you bypass comparison and re-seed baselines. Use only with a second engineer present. The break-glass recovery passphrase is recorded below.

unlock words, hahip-baduf: holwyn-istath-julvan